Finding Back Door Installers Near You: A Comprehensive Guide
When it concerns home improvement, few jobs provide as much value as setting up a new back entrance. Whether it's for security functions, improving curb appeal, or enhancing energy performance, a quality back door can raise your home's performance and appearance. Nevertheless, installing a back door is not a DIY job that most can undertake without the right abilities and tools. This is where discovering a professional back entrance installer near you becomes important.
Why Hire a Professional Back Door Installer?Know-how and Experience
Professional installers have the technical skills and experience to make sure that the back entrance is fitted properly. They comprehend the subtleties of door installation, consisting of how to effectively align the door frame, adjust hinges, and guarantee that the door runs efficiently.
Time Efficiency
Setting up a back door can be a time-consuming endeavor, especially for those not familiar with the process. Professionals can typically finish the installation much faster, permitting homeowners to resume their normal routines without considerable disruption.
Guarantee and Guarantees
Lots of professional installation services offer warranties on their work. This not just secures your financial investment however also supplies peace of mind knowing that the work is ensured.
Access to Quality Materials
Professional installers frequently have great relationships with suppliers, providing access to high-quality doors and materials that might not be easily available to the average customer.
Elements to Consider When Choosing an Installer
When looking for a back entrance installer near you, keep the following aspects in mind:

Discovering a reputable back door installer can be facilitated with the following techniques:
1. Online Search
Use online search engine to try to find "back door installers near me." Websites such as Yelp, Angie's List, and Google Maps can provide rankings, reviews, and contact information.
2. Local Recommendations
Ask good friends, household, or neighbors if they can suggest experienced installers. Personal recommendations often lead to credible service companies.
3. Home Improvement Stores
Go to local hardware or home enhancement stores. Personnel frequently have connections with reputable installers and might even provide installation services themselves.
4. Social Network and Community Apps
Platforms like Facebook, Nextdoor, or community online forums can be excellent resources for local suggestions. You can post your request and get reactions from neighborhood members.
5. Trade Associations
Consider contacting trade associations connected to home improvement, such as the National Association of Home Builders (NAHB) or the Home Builders Association (HBA). These companies can assist you find qualified professionals.
FAQs
Q: How much does it generally cost to hire a back door installer?A: Costs can differ extensively
based upon area, door type, and installer experience. On average, installation costs can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000. Q: How long does it take to set up a back door?A: A normal back door installation can take anywhere
from 2 to 4 hours depending upon the complexity of the task. Q: Do I require to obtain an authorization for back entrance installation?A: Permit requirementscan vary by place. It's advisable to contact your local building department before starting any installation. Q: Can back doors be energy efficient?A: Absolutely! Lots of modern-day back doors are created with energy-efficient materials and
insulation, which can help in reducing heating
and cooling costs. Setting up a back entrance is a task best delegated professionals, given the importance of proper installation for durability, energy effectiveness, and security
